A heavy, rounded sans with substantial stroke mass and soft corners throughout. Curves are broadly circular and terminals tend to finish bluntly, giving letters a sturdy, cut-from-solid feel. Counters are relatively compact and apertures are somewhat tight, creating dense texture in text, while the overall proportions stay open and readable at display sizes. The digit set follows the same robust, rounded construction with simplified forms and strong silhouettes.
Best suited for headlines, posters, and bold brand moments where strong presence and quick readability matter. It also fits packaging and logo work that benefits from a friendly, rounded voice, and can serve as a display face for playful editorial or social graphics.
The overall tone is friendly and energetic, with a playful, slightly retro personality. Its chunky shapes and rounded joins feel approachable rather than technical, making it read as upbeat and attention-grabbing.
Likely designed as a high-impact display sans that prioritizes warmth and immediacy. The rounded geometry and dense weight suggest an intention to deliver cheerful emphasis and clear silhouettes in large sizes.
The design emphasizes silhouette and rhythm over fine detail: inner spaces are kept small and the black weight dominates, which helps it hold up in short words and headlines. The lowercase shows a casual, bouncy feel with single-storey forms and rounded bowls that reinforce an informal voice.
